    Lock cell formatting but allow data changes

    Hi everyone.

    I have a excel spreadsheet, which I've formatted all my colum width's and height. The data chnages and is updated by importing a txt csv file, however everytime I import data, the formatting changes.

    I've tried locking the cells I don't want to change and then protecting the worksheet, but when I do this I can't select Import Data from the Data menu.

    Anybody any ideas if I can do this or not???

    Re: Lock cell formatting but allow data changes

    Hi,

    import your CSV file on a different sheet, then copy all, go to your formatted sheet and paste special - Values only. This will preserve the formatting.
